Why inpatient detoxification exists in the very first place

Detox is typically misconstrued as the whole treatment procedure. It is not. Detox is the front end, the period when the body begins clearing materials and getting used to their lack. The objective is not just to get a person through an unpleasant few days. The goal is to do it safely, decrease complications, manage signs, and produce enough physical and mental stability for the next stage of care.

For some people, outpatient detox can be appropriate. For others, it is inadequate. Inpatient care has a tendency to make one of the most feeling when there is a background of hefty or long term material use, prior difficult withdrawals, co-occurring psychological health and wellness signs and symptoms, unsteady housing, inadequate support in your home, or considerable medical concerns. It is additionally often the better option when there is a high risk of leaving therapy early if cravings, stress and anxiety, or pain spike.

I have seen individuals arrive convinced they simply require "a location to get through a couple evenings." By the 2nd day, it ends up being evident that what they required was monitoring, hydration, medicine assistance, rest, peace of mind, and a setting where nobody can hand them the substance they were attempting to stop. That distinction issues. Willpower can be sincere and still be no suit for withdrawal.

What intake generally looks like

The very first day of inpatient detoxification is normally much more management than significant, though it can really feel emotionally extreme. Most centers start with a full analysis. Staff want to know what compounds have actually been utilized, in what amounts, how just recently, and by what route. They will additionally inquire about prescriptions, alcohol usage, previous detox attempts, seizure history, psychological wellness diagnoses, sleep patterns, and any type of history of self-harm or overdose.

This component can really feel repetitive because several staff members may ask comparable inquiries. That is not always inefficiency. It is frequently a secure. Nurses, clinical carriers, and scientific personnel each require a clear picture of danger. If a patient reports one amount to an admissions planner and an extremely different amount to nursing later, that inconsistency can affect medication preparation and safety monitoring.

Urine medicine testing prevails. Standard laboratory job may be gotten depending on the program and the individual's problem. Vitals are examined, usually continuously in the early period. If someone arrives dehydrated, overwhelmed, exceptionally anxious, or with signs of severe medical distress, the first steps may concentrate much less on routine consumption and even more on prompt stabilization.

Family participants sometimes expect a quick handoff. Actually, the very first couple of hours can be slow. That is typical. Great detoxification programs do not rush the clinical evaluation.

The initially 24-hour can be unpredictable

One factor inpatient medicine detox is useful is that the first day hardly ever follows a basic manuscript. Withdrawal beginning depends upon the substance, the quantity made use of, whether numerous compounds are involved, and the individual's metabolism and wellness status.

An individual detoxing from short-acting opioids might begin feeling signs and symptoms within hours. A person withdrawing from benzodiazepines may not peak immediately, and that delay can produce incorrect self-confidence. Stimulant withdrawal may look less medically dramatic on the surface yet can bring squashing depression, exhaustion, agitation, or despondence. Alcohol withdrawal can escalate rapidly in some cases and must never be minimized.

Patients typically ask whether detox indicates they will certainly be heavily sedated. Generally, no. The objective is not to knock a person out. The objective is to keep them risk-free and as comfy as clinically ideal while the body rectifies. There are times when remainder becomes a huge part of the very early procedure due to the fact that the individual has not rested properly in days or weeks. Even then, mindful tracking remains central.

The opening night can be the hardest mentally. When the adrenaline of getting confessed fades, discomfort and uncertainty typically rise. Some clients end up being uneasy and urge they can handle it in your home. Others are frightened by signs they did not expect, such as sweating, tremblings, body pains, panic, queasiness, temperature swings, or vibrant dreams. Knowledgeable personnel recognize this pattern. Their tranquility, practical method assists greater than people realize.

How medical surveillance works

A strong medical medicine detox program treats withdrawal as a scientific procedure, not a personality test. Staff generally check high blood pressure, pulse, temperature level, hydration, mental standing, and sign severity. The timetable differs. At an early stage, checks might occur frequently, particularly if there is issue regarding seizures, serious autonomic instability, complication, or medicine response.

The finest programs do not depend on a one-size-fits-all method. 2 people detoxing from the same basic classification of medication can need really various treatment. One may need hostile symptom monitoring due to past difficulties. Another may need a lighter touch because of liver problems, age, maternity, or level of sensitivity to certain medications.

Medical suppliers usually reassess throughout the keep instead of setting a plan once and going away. That matters since withdrawal progresses. Medications may become part of the plan

People in some cases get here with a couple of concerns. They worry they will certainly either get no assistance for signs and symptoms, or they will certainly be offered a complex stack of medicines without explanation. Neither must happen in a well-run program.

Medication use throughout detoxification depends upon the material and the individual. In opioid detox, drugs might be made use of to decrease withdrawal severity, convenience desires, and sustain a much safer change. In alcohol or benzodiazepine withdrawal, medications can be important for protecting against hazardous difficulties. Other drugs may be made use of for nausea, looseness of the bowels, sleeping disorders, muscle discomfort, anxiousness, or elevated blood pressure.

There is a practical equilibrium here. Overmedicating can cloud evaluation and develop brand-new issues. Undermedicating can drive people out of therapy or place them at risk. Excellent scientific judgment sits in between those extremes.

It is additionally worth claiming clearly that detoxification drug is not a moral faster way. I have seen individuals feel virtually apologetic for needing symptom alleviation, as if enduring proves seriousness. That frame of mind is common and unhelpful. If a medicine can decrease risk and aid a person continue to be in care, it is serving a genuine medical purpose.

Not every withdrawal looks the same

Families frequently anticipate detoxification to unravel in a solitary recognizable pattern, however material type transforms the image significantly.

Opioid withdrawal is typically intensely awkward as opposed to normally deadly by itself, though difficulties can still develop, particularly with dehydration, co-occurring problems, or relapse danger after discharge. Individuals may manage chills, sweating, stomach cramping, throwing up, looseness of the bowels, uneasyness, bone-deep pains, and subduing desires. The misery is actual, and individuals often take too lightly just how quickly that discomfort can push them back to use.

Alcohol and benzodiazepine withdrawal should have special care. These are the cases where not being watched detox can become dangerous. Symptoms may consist of tremblings, anxiousness, sleep problems, sweating, elevated heart rate, and in much more extreme instances hallucinations, seizures, or delirium. This is among the clearest reasons individuals seek drug detoxification Hand Coastline Gardens programs with true clinical oversight as opposed to attempting to "tough it out" at home.

Stimulant withdrawal can be quieter from the outside however need to not be rejected. People may sleep for lengthy stretches, really feel mentally flat, come to be cranky, or sink into extensive clinical depression. Some experience paranoia or serious anxiety. The risk here is not always noticeable on a crucial sign screen. It frequently stays in the individual's frame of mind, sadness, and susceptability to instant relapse.

Cannabis, artificial substances, and polysubstance use can likewise complicate the picture. In the real world, numerous detoxification admissions are not clean book cases. Individuals make use of combinations, they are not constantly sure what was in what they took, and street supply is much less predictable than ever before. That uncertainty is one more reason clinical monitoring matters.

The emotional side of detoxification is usually stronger than expected

Physical withdrawal obtains most of the attention, however the mental impact can hit equally as tough. When material use quits, feelings that have actually been numbed, delayed, or chemically rerouted can return fast. Shame is common. So is grief. Some people really feel anger. Others really feel raw fear at the thought of encountering life without the compound that has organized their days.

An individual could invest the early morning requesting for help and the evening insisting they made a mistake by coming. That swing is not uncommon. Ambivalence belongs to addiction therapy, particularly in the earliest stage.

Inpatient setups aid here since assistance is constructed into the atmosphere. Team can reality-check panic, urge hydration and food, reroute tragic reasoning, and aid individuals get through the following few hours rather than mentally duke it outing the following 6 months. That might seem straightforward, however in early detoxification the horizon needs to stay short.

Therapy throughout detox is commonly lighter and extra encouraging than deeper trauma work. This is not normally the minute for intensive excavation. Many individuals initially require alignment, confidence, and a standard feeling that they can survive the process.

What the setup is really like

People listen to "inpatient" and picture either a medical facility ward or a locked institution. Detoxification centers differ, however numerous in Palm Coastline County aim for something in between professional safety and security and household tranquility. Expect framework, supervision, and guidelines, however not always a sterile environment.

Rooms may be shared or exclusive depending on the facility. Dishes are scheduled, though people early in withdrawal might eat really bit initially. Hydration is urged regularly. Sleep is commonly fragmented. Some individuals spend the first day primarily in bed. Others speed, shower repetitively, or ask the very same inquiry every hour because discomfort makes time move strangely.

The ambience of a detox system matters greater than pamphlets suggest. You can feel the distinction between a place that treats individuals as troubles to manage and one that treats them as individuals under stress and anxiety. Considerate tone, timely action to signs, and clear communication frequently figure out whether somebody stays.

How long inpatient detoxification normally lasts

This is just one of one of the most typical concerns, and there is no universal solution. Several inpatient detoxification stays loss someplace in the range of several days to regarding a week, though some are much shorter and some longer. The timeline depends on the substance, seriousness of dependence, clinical difficulties, and whether the person is transitioning directly into one more level of care.

An usual disappointment occurs when patients think discharge will certainly take place the minute they really feel a little far better physically. Medical professionals assume in different ways. They want to see a level of security that recommends the patient can operate securely in the following setup, whether that is residential treatment, partial a hospital stay, outpatient care, or home with close follow-up.

The contrary problem likewise comes up. Some people expect to really feel totally regular by the end of detox. Usually they do not. Acute withdrawal may reduce, yet rest disturbance, mood instability, low energy, and food cravings can stick around. That does not imply detoxification failed. It means detoxification did its work and currently the actual recuperation job needs to continue.

Why detoxification is only the very first step

One of the hardest truths in addiction care is that detox alone seldom holds. A person can finish a medically supervised withdrawal and still go to high threat of regression if nothing modifications later. Tolerance falls quickly, which makes return to previous usage specifically dangerous. This is a significant overdose danger, particularly with opioids.

That is why discharge preparation matters virtually as much as admission. A high quality detox program begins talking about next actions early, not in a rushed discussion an hour before launch. Clients require a strategy that fits their actual lives, not an idyllic variation of them.

For some, the following step is domestic treatment. For others, it might be outpatient treatment with medication assistance, psychological follow-up, treatment, recuperation meetings, or sober housing. The ideal level of treatment relies on relapse history, home setting, work responsibilities, psychological health demands, and readiness to engage.

Questions worth asking before selecting a program

Families are frequently so happy to find an open bed that they forget to ask fundamental but crucial questions. A brief conversation with admissions can expose a lot concerning whether a program is clinically strong and transparent.

Consider asking:

  1. Is medical staff on website around the clock, or only on call?
  2. What experience does the program have with the particular substance involved?
  3. How are co-occurring mental wellness symptoms dealt with throughout detox?
  4. What medicines are generally utilized, and exactly how are choices clarified to patients?
  5. What takes place after detox, and how does the program arrange proceeded care?

You are not searching for sleek sales language. You are searching for straight, concrete answers.

The family function during inpatient detox

Families commonly really feel helpless during detox due to the fact that their enjoyed one is ultimately in treatment, yet they can not fix what is taking place hour by hour. That vulnerability can come out as over-calling, pushing for updates staff can not legitimately share, or trying to bargain exceptions to program rules.

The most useful family position is consistent, tranquil, and boundaried. If interaction is permitted, quick helpful get in touch with usually works much better than psychological pressure. This is not the minute to litigate previous damage, demand pledges, or ask the client to reassure everybody else. Early detoxification tightens an individual's data transfer. They might barely have the ability to consume, sleep, or endure light, much less manage family members dynamics.

That stated, household info can be medically important. If the client has a seizure history, current self-destructive statements, serious psychiatric signs and symptoms, or a pattern of leaving treatment when signs climb, staff must understand. Details that appear humiliating can be clinically relevant.

Frequently Ask Questions about Drug Detox in Palm Beach Gardens, FL


How long is a stay at a detox center in Palm Beach Gardens?

A stay at a medical detox center typically lasts between 3 and 10 days. The exact length depends on the substance involved, withdrawal symptoms, and the individual's overall health. Some people require additional monitoring if withdrawal is severe. Detox is often followed by ongoing addiction treatment.

What is a cheap detox in Palm Beach Gardens?

Lower-cost detox options may include publicly funded programs, nonprofit organizations, or facilities that accept Medicaid or other insurance plans. Community health programs may also provide financial assistance for eligible individuals. Costs vary depending on the level of care and insurance coverage. A medical assessment helps determine the most appropriate detox setting.

Can you have visitors during medical detox in Palm Beach Gardens?

Visitor policies vary by detox facility and may depend on the patient's medical condition and stage of treatment. Some programs limit visitors during the early stages of detox to support safety and recovery. Others allow scheduled visits after medical stabilization. Patients should review the facility's visitation policies before admission.

Do residential treatment centers work for teens in Palm Beach Gardens?

Residential treatment can be effective for teens with significant substance use or co-occurring mental health conditions. These programs provide structured care, counseling, education, and family involvement when appropriate. Success depends on individual participation, family support, and continued care after treatment. Treatment plans are typically tailored to the adolescent's needs.

What drug takes the longest to detox in Palm Beach Gardens?

The detox timeline varies depending on the substance and individual factors. Long-acting drugs and substances that accumulate in body fat, such as cannabis in frequent users, may remain in the body longer than many other drugs. Physical withdrawal timelines also differ between substances. A medical evaluation helps determine the expected detox process.

What happens during medical detox in Palm Beach Gardens?

Medical detox provides supervised care while the body adjusts to the absence of drugs or alcohol. Healthcare professionals monitor withdrawal symptoms and may provide medications, fluids, nutritional support, and regular health assessments when appropriate. The goal is to manage withdrawal safely and reduce complications. Patients are often evaluated for continued treatment after detox.

What happens on day 3 of detox in Palm Beach Gardens?

By the third day of detox, withdrawal symptoms may begin improving for many people, although some continue to experience discomfort. For alcohol and certain drugs, the risk of severe withdrawal complications may still be present during this period. Medical supervision helps manage symptoms and respond to emergencies if needed. Recovery progresses differently for each individual.

How many days does it take to fully detox your body in Palm Beach Gardens?

Most medically supervised detox programs last between 3 and 10 days, depending on the substance involved and the severity of withdrawal. Some drugs leave the body within a few days, while others remain detectable for longer periods. Detox timelines also vary based on metabolism and overall health. Ongoing treatment often follows detox to support long-term recovery.

How long do you need to detox before rehab in Palm Beach Gardens?

Detox generally lasts between 3 and 10 days before rehabilitation begins, depending on the substance used and withdrawal severity. Many people transition directly into inpatient or outpatient treatment after completing detox. The exact timing depends on medical stability and clinical recommendations. Detox is typically the first step in a comprehensive treatment plan.

Does detox have to be inpatient in Palm Beach Gardens?

Detox does not always require inpatient care. People with mild withdrawal symptoms and stable health may be eligible for outpatient detox under medical supervision. Inpatient detox is often recommended for severe withdrawal, co-occurring medical conditions, or a higher risk of complications. A healthcare professional determines the safest level of care through a clinical assessment.
